Description
Kentucky Cream Pull Candy is a delightful homemade treat known for its creamy texture and sweet flavor, perfect for indulging or gifting.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ups granulated sugar
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1/2 cup light corn syrup
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 tablespoon butter for greasing hands and surface
Instructions
- In a saucepan, mix the granulated sugar, heavy cream, light corn syrup, and salt. Stir over medium heat until the sugar dissolves.
- Continue stirring until the mixture reaches a rolling boil and cook until it reaches the soft ball stage, around 234°F to 240°F.
- Remove from heat and add in the vanilla extract, stirring well.
- Allow the mixture to cool for a few minutes, then butter your hands and work surface.
- Pour the mixture onto the buttered surface and let it cool until safe to handle, about 10-15 minutes.
- Once cool enough, knead and stretch the candy until smooth, then shape it into desired forms.
Notes
- This candy can be shaped into individual pieces or formed into a log.
- Make sure to work quickly, as the candy will harden as it cools.
